> > > > > > On Fri, Sep 6, 2019 at 5:47 PM Arnd Bergmann <arnd@xxxxxxxx> wrote:
> > > > > > > Without the frame pointer enabled, return_address() is an inline
> > > > > > > function and does not need to be exported, as shown by this warning:
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> WARNING: "return_address" [vmlinux] is a static E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> Move the E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L() into the #ifdef as well.
